THE GLEANER MINUTE: Soldier, attackers killed on Molynes Road | Fiery Mountain View protest
Jan 27th, 2025 | Category: The Gleaner Minute | 1:47#JamaicaGleaner JANUARY 27, 2025: A Jamaica Defence Force soldier, 26-year-old Private Fernando Dixon was killed in an attack along Molynes Road in St Andrew early Monday morning... Upset residents on Monday mounted fiery roadblocks along sections of Mountain View in St Andrew to protest a fatal police shooting… With new evidence showing a direct link between alcohol consumption and cancer, the National Council on Drug Abuse has issued a stark warning to Jamaicans about the dangers of alcohol misuse… IN SPORTS: Jamaica Premier League leader Mount Pleasant Football Academy created history on Sunday after they defeated Tivoli Gardens 1-0 to extend their winning streak to 11 matches.
